Tavares Deal Signals a Smarter, Stronger Maple Leafs Strategy

With the signing of John Tavares to a four-year, team-friendly extension worth $4,388,420 per season, the Toronto Maple Leafs have one more foundational piece in place for their 2025–26 roster.…

Seravalli: Maple Leafs are ‘ultimate winners’ for retaining Tavares

Frank Seravalli joins Martine Gaillard and Faizal Khamisa to discuss the action around the NHL, including the Maple Leafs extending John Tavares, updates on Matthew Knies’ situation, the Canadiens’ trade for Noah Dobson, and more.
